3. Applications of Alisma orientalis Extract

3.1. Traditional Medicine

In traditional Chinese medicine, Alisma orientalis has a long - standing application history. It is often used to treat various diseases such as edema, urinary disorders, and damp - heat syndromes. The extract of Alisma orientalis is believed to have diuretic, anti - inflammatory, and lipid - lowering effects in traditional medicine concepts.

3.2. Modern Pharmaceuticals

  • Diuretic Effects: Modern pharmacological studies have confirmed that Alisma orientalis extract has significant diuretic effects. It can increase the excretion of urine, which is beneficial for patients with fluid retention or hypertension.
  • Antihyperlipidemic Activity: The extract also shows potential in reducing blood lipid levels. It may act on lipid metabolism pathways in the body, helping to lower cholesterol and triglyceride levels.
  • Anti - inflammatory Properties: Some components in the extract have anti - inflammatory effects, which can be used to treat inflammatory diseases or as an adjuvant in anti - inflammatory therapy.

4.3. Comparison in Traditional Medicine Applications

  • Compatibility: In traditional medicine, Alisma orientalis can be combined with other herbs to form prescriptions for different syndromes. Its compatibility with other herbs is an important aspect that distinguishes it from some single - use herbs. For example, when combined with Poria cocos, it can enhance the diuretic and damp - removing effects.
  • Treatment Spectrum: Different traditional medicine herbs have different treatment spectra. Alisma orientalis is mainly used for water - dampness - related syndromes, while other herbs may be used for qi - deficiency, blood - stasis, or other types of syndromes.
